From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: bug-gnu-emacs@gnu.org (Emacs bug Tracking System) Newsgroups: gmane.emacs.bugs Subject: bug#5256: marked as done (conjunct formation should follow input sequence when inserting text) Date: Mon, 28 Dec 2009 09:39:02 +0000 Message-ID: References: <3f2beab60912280138i6348afc0h53c3349aca24c7f@mail.gmail.com> <3f2beab60912210723x4f424fa9l2b842824aff1a546@mail.gmail.com>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="----------=_1261993142-4307-0" X-Trace: ger.gmane.org 1261994899 24837 80.91.229.12 (28 Dec 2009 10:08:19 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Mon, 28 Dec 2009 10:08:19 +0000 (UTC) Cc: emacs-bug-tracker@debbugs.gnu.org To: Praveen A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Mon Dec 28 11:08:11 2009 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1NPCWJ-0001z1-BU for geb-bug-gnu-emacs@m.gmane.org; Mon, 28 Dec 2009 11:08:11 +0100 Original-Received: from localhost ([127.0.0.1]:52502 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1NPCWJ-0000z5-7t for geb-bug-gnu-emacs@m.gmane.org; Mon, 28 Dec 2009 05:08:11 -0500 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1NPCWC-0000ye-Bc for bug-gnu-emacs@gnu.org; Mon, 28 Dec 2009 05:08:04 -0500 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1NPCW6-0000xJ-QH for bug-gnu-emacs@gnu.org; Mon, 28 Dec 2009 05:08:03 -0500 Original-Received: from [199.232.76.173] (port=38604 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1NPCVw-0000vG-Cy; Mon, 28 Dec 2009 05:07:48 -0500 Original-Received: from [140.186.70.43] (port=34769 helo=debbugs.gnu.org) by monty-python.gnu.org with esmtps (TLS-1.0:RSA_AES_256_CBC_SHA1:32) (Exim 4.60) (envelope-from ) id 1NPCVv-0003UJ-HD; Mon, 28 Dec 2009 05:07:48 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.69) (envelope-from ) id 1NPC46-00017V-1x; Mon, 28 Dec 2009 04:39:02 -0500 X-Mailer: MIME-tools 5.427 (Entity 5.427) X-Loop: bug-gnu-emacs@gnu.org X-Emacs-PR-Message: closed 5256 X-Emacs-PR-Package: emacs X-detected-operating-system: by monty-python.gnu.org: GNU/Linux 2.6 (newer, 3) X-BeenThere: bug-gnu-emacs@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:33790 Archived-At: This is a multi-part message in MIME format... ------------=_1261993142-4307-0 Content-Disposition: inline Content-Transfer-Encoding: quoted-printable Content-Type: text/plain; charset=utf-8 Your message dated Mon, 28 Dec 2009 15:08:20 +0530 with message-id <3f2beab60912280138i6348afc0h53c3349aca24c7f@mail.gmail.com> and subject line Re: bug#5256: conjunct formation should follow input seque= nce when inserting text has caused the Emacs bug report #5256, regarding conjunct formation should follow input sequence when inserting te= xt to be marked as done. This means that you claim that the problem has been dealt with. If this is not the case it is now your responsibility to reopen the bug report if necessary, and/or fix the problem forthwith. (NB: If you are a system administrator and have no idea what this message is talking about, this may indicate a serious mail system misconfiguration somewhere. Please contact bug-gnu-emacs@gnu.org immediately.) --=20 5256: http://debbugs.gnu.org/cgi/bugreport.cgi?bug=3D5256 Emacs Bug Tracking System Contact bug-gnu-emacs@gnu.org with problems ------------=_1261993142-4307-0 Content-Type: message/rfc822 Content-Disposition: inline Content-Transfer-Encoding: 7bit Received: (at submit) by debbugs.gnu.org; 21 Dec 2009 15:24:09 +0000 Received: from localhost ([127.0.0.1] hel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1NMk7F-00088Y-MO for submit@debbugs.gnu.org; Mon, 21 Dec 2009 10:24:09 -0500 Received: from fencepost.gnu.org ([140.186.70.10])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1NMk72-00088B-PT for submit@debbugs.gnu.org; Mon, 21 Dec 2009 10:24:09 -0500 Received: from mail.gnu.org ([199.232.76.166]:45863 helo=mx10.gnu.org) by fencepost.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1NMk6y-0006rj-2D for submit@debbugs.gnu.org; Mon, 21 Dec 2009 10:23:52 -0500 Received: from Debian-exim by monty-python.gnu.org with spam-scanned (Exim 4.60) (envelope-from ) id 1NMk6w-0006Kp-PD for submit@debbugs.gnu.org; Mon, 21 Dec 2009 10:23:51 -0500 X-Spam-Checker-Version: SpamAssassin 3.1.0 (2005-09-13) on monty-python X-Spam-Level: X-Spam-Status: No, score=-1.7 required=5.0 tests=AWL,BAYES_00, DNS_FROM_RFC_POST,UNPARSEABLE_RELAY autolearn=no version=3.1.0 Received: from lists.gnu.org ([199.232.76.165]:60292)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1NMk6w-0006Kh-ET for submit@debbugs.gnu.org; Mon, 21 Dec 2009 10:23:50 -0500 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1NMk6w-0003NE-4i for bug-gnu-emacs@gnu.org; Mon, 21 Dec 2009 10:23:50 -0500 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1NMk6p-0003Di-Hx for bug-gnu-emacs@gnu.org; Mon, 21 Dec 2009 10:23:48 -0500 Received: from [199.232.76.173] (port=45309 hel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1NMk6p-0003DL-Cr for bug-gnu-emacs@gnu.org; Mon, 21 Dec 2009 10:23:43 -0500 Received: from mail-yx0-f191.google.com ([209.85.210.191]:40375)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1NMk6p-0006II-3a for bug-gnu-emacs@gnu.org; Mon, 21 Dec 2009 10:23:43 -0500 Received: by yxe29 with SMTP id 29so14643758yxe.14 for ; Mon, 21 Dec 2009 07:23:42 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:mime-version:received:date:message-id:subject :from:to:cc:content-type:content-transfer-encoding; bh=qx0L+L1v6f5vqT9RSrH53WoA3QbkSyl4IMGeJ8FtT0g=; b=etCUSl8odgbxxoDKWm0ts2+MgECjM2Nw4lm1BNCSCKSB5RYw64VgKZDYibfNuPJ6VE 2ePE7s91WOWFS7uWJRwbT7O0FdIed7lj3FPbDvh+pNSOX1EEI3HVrAAvSan+aqsCMb1c bgub1ulg9siaMyFjL3fHSL1+fPWVYB1ndUpkg=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:date:message-id:subject:from:to:cc:content-type :content-transfer-encoding; b=BLdgoNY78EgGs6/631Ya1Pbh08xcKLtf1q6Sg/i/LQq5DZTyH6ca3oBgSlkD9anMfF vmZhnJ0+4ul41wgVxgxBROI9PndwNAEc0JRWfBvS/LUT1LeTng64r/2eFBku4thq3boV 4gdHEC/UpNTjb0ZyJUITQCf3e6rCye97LikC8= MIME-Version: 1.0 Received: by 10.150.44.27 with SMTP id r27mr11249735ybr.263.1261409021857; Mon, 21 Dec 2009 07:23:41 -0800 (PST) Date: Mon, 21 Dec 2009 20:53:41 +0530 Message-ID: <3f2beab60912210723x4f424fa9l2b842824aff1a546@mail.gmail.com> Subject: conjunct formation should follow input sequence when inserting text From: Praveen A To: bug-gnu-emacs@gnu.org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able X-detected-operating-system: by monty-python.gnu.org: GNU/Linux 2.6 (newer, 2) X-detected-operating-system: by monty-python.gnu.org: GNU/Linux 2.6, seldom 2.4 (older, 4) X-Debbugs-Envelope-To: submit Cc: psatpute@redhat.com, Parag Nemade , suresh X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.11 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: debbugs-submit-bounces@debbugs.gnu.org Errors-To: debbugs-submit-bounces@debbugs.gnu.org Example to illustrate this bug is =E0=B4=85=E0=B4=AA=E0=B5=8D=E2=80=8C=E0= =B4=B2=E0=B5=8B=E0=B4=A1=E0=B5=8D (upload). >>> a=3Du'=E0=B4=B2=E0=B5=8B=E0=B4=A1=E0=B5=8D' >>> b=3Du'=E0=B4=85=E0=B4=AA=E0=B5=8D' >>> c=3Du'=E0=B4=85=E0=B4=AA=E0=B5=8D=E2=80=8C=E0=B4=B2=E0=B5=8B=E0=B4=A1= =E0=B5=8D' >>> print repr(c) u'\u0d05\u0d2a\u0d4d\u200c\u0d32\u0d4b\u0d21\u0d4d' >>> d=3Du'=E0=B4=85=E0=B4=AA=E0=B5=8D=E0=B4=B2=E0=B5=8B=E2=80=8C=E0=B4=A1= =E0=B5=8D' >>> print repr(d) u'\u0d05\u0d2a\u0d4d\u0d32\u0d4b\u200c\u0d21\u0d4d' >>> Here ZWNJ is added to prevent formation of conjunct 'pla' (\u0d2a\u0d4d\u0d= 32). Enter =E0=B4=B2=E0=B5=8B=E0=B4=A1=E0=B5=8D (\u0d32\u0d4b\u0d21\u0d4d) first= , move cursor to the beginning of the word, now enter =E0=B4=85=E0=B4=AA=E0=B5=8D (\u0d05\u0d2a\= u0d4d). Now ZWNJ entered will not be after 0d4d, but after the conjunct 'plo' (\u0d2a\u0d4d\u0d32\u0d4b). gedit/pango has the correct behavior, wherein the ZWNJ is inserted after 0d4d breaking the conjunct 'pla' (\u0d2a\u0d4d\u0d32) as expected. GNU Emacs 23.1.90.1 (x86_64-unknown-linux-gnu, GTK+ Version 2.18.3) of 2009-12-18 on savannah --=20 =E0=B4=AA=E0=B5=8D=E0=B4=B0=E0=B4=B5=E0=B5=80=E0=B4=A3=E0=B5=8D=E2=80=8D = =E0=B4=85=E0=B4=B0=E0=B4=BF=E0=B4=AE=E0=B5=8D=E0=B4=AA=E0=B5=8D=E0=B4=B0=E0= =B4=A4=E0=B5=8D=E0=B4=A4=E0=B5=8A=E0=B4=9F=E0=B4=BF=E0=B4=AF=E0=B4=BF=E0=B4= =B2=E0=B5=8D=E2=80=8D I know my rights; I want my phone call! What use is a phone call, if you are unable to speak? (as seen on /.) Join The DRM Elimination Crew Now! http://fci.wikia.com/wiki/Anti-DRM-Campaign ------------=_1261993142-4307-0 Content-Type: message/rfc822 Content-Disposition: inline Content-Transfer-Encoding: 7bit Received: (at 5256-done) by debbugs.gnu.org; 28 Dec 2009 09:38:26 +0000 Received: from localhost ([127.0.0.1] hel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1NPC3W-000179-Bh for submit@debbugs.gnu.org; Mon, 28 Dec 2009 04:38:26 -0500 Received: from mail-gx0-f226.google.com ([209.85.217.226])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1NPC3U-000173-Ld for 5256-done@debbugs.gnu.org; Mon, 28 Dec 2009 04:38:25 -0500 Received: by gxk26 with SMTP id 26so10236747gxk.19 for <5256-done@debbugs.gnu.org>; Mon, 28 Dec 2009 01:38:20 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:mime-version:received:in-reply-to:references :date:message-id:subject:from:to:cc:content-type :content-transfer-encoding; bh=T/fi7JHZVj9M6YoG8WIEhsWZQoE/yDUbXKL0lvqrEK8=; b=qxDQx/WsidZxX5uscWHpHtKhrJmbnO5nmjcYwIKmjmDTzVm6yTZ0hJnOKhX7DQuNkX AD1qLoUOtwbuOzRuJvxIBve+lF0tXay6c0H5sH9MOsdAbPmVJhYq1jmIXT2y7jiGsYBc C3RUk/jrDAdfrpV9N07seqK5GDn8fZ7O5A+nU= D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:in-reply-to:references:date:message-id:subject:from:to :cc:content-type:content-transfer-encoding; b=oKsETbjOUlZ+OkU9HlycZlTjHecU1E4yTvkOax2SMxQbGDFrBYXzIniKpDSDU01Adi yGJvDRyY4QI668T2AJw4VEFZ5GQNMMdJu2KNlscPJ7/ZfqCwvph/NWmw4N8RpXcyVsHW TmcHXTyCsMkRwBukJPnJjWvIJcacrGd8yEHTo= MIME-Version: 1.0 Received: by 10.150.105.17 with SMTP id d17mr22000266ybc.344.1261993100420; Mon, 28 Dec 2009 01:38:20 -0800 (PST) In-Reply-To: References: <3f2beab60912210723x4f424fa9l2b842824aff1a546@mail.gmail.com> Date: Mon, 28 Dec 2009 15:08:20 +0530 Message-ID: <3f2beab60912280138i6348afc0h53c3349aca24c7f@mail.gmail.com> Subject: Re: bug#5256: conjunct formation should follow input sequence when inserting text From: Praveen A To: Kenichi Handa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: base64 X-Spam-Score: -2.6 (--) X-Debbugs-Envelope-To: 5256-done Cc: 5256-done@debbugs.gnu.org X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.11 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: debbugs-submit-bounces@debbugs.gnu.org Errors-To: debbugs-submit-bounces@debbugs.gnu.org X-Spam-Score: -2.6 (--) MjAwOS8xMi8yNSBLZW5pY2hpIEhhbmRhIDxoYW5kYUBtMTduLm9yZz46Cj4gSSBmaXhlZCBpdC4g wqBQbGVhc2UgdHJ5IGFnYWluIHdpdGggdGhlIGxhc3Rlc3QgY29kZS4KClRoYW5rcy4gSSB0ZXN0 ZWQgaXQgYW5kIGl0IGlzIHdvcmtpbmcgYmVhdXRpZnVsbHkuCgotIFByYXZlZW4KLS0gCuC0quC1 jeC0sOC0teC1gOC0o+C1jeKAjSDgtIXgtLDgtL/gtK7gtY3gtKrgtY3gtLDgtKTgtY3gtKTgtYrg tJ/gtL/gtK/gtL/gtLLgtY3igI0KPEdQTHYyPiBJIGtub3cgbXkgcmlnaHRzOyBJIHdhbnQgbXkg cGhvbmUgY2FsbCEKPERSTT4gV2hhdCB1c2UgaXMgYSBwaG9uZSBjYWxsLCBpZiB5b3UgYXJlIHVu YWJsZSB0byBzcGVhaz8KKGFzIHNlZW4gb24gLy4pCkpvaW4gVGhlIERSTSBFbGltaW5hdGlvbiBD cmV3IE5vdyEKaHR0cDovL2ZjaS53aWtpYS5jb20vd2lraS9BbnRpLURSTS1DYW1wYWlnbgo= ------------=_1261993142-4307-0--